Fluid intake is a crucial aspect of recovery after exercise. When people engage in physical activity, their bodies lose fluids through sweat and breathing. This depletion can lead to fluid loss, which negatively impacts recovery and overall effectiveness. To ensure ideal recovery, it is important to understand efficient hydration strategies. Staying adequately hydrated helps replenish lost liquids, restore electrolyte balance, and support physical recovery.
One efficient method for hydration is to drink water prior to, during, and following exercise. Taking in water prior to exercise readies the system for physical activity and helps avert dehydration from the outset. Throughout exercise, taking small sips of water can sustain hydration levels, especially during extended or intense workouts. After exercising, consuming water restores lost fluids and aids in restoration. It is important to listen to the system and drink water when experiencing thirsty, as this is a instinctive indicator of hydration requirements.
In furthermore to water, sports drinks can be helpful for hydration, especially after vigorous exercise. These beverages often include electrolytes such as sodium and potassium, which are lost through perspiration. Restoring these electrolytes is important for muscle performance and overall restoration. However, it is essential to select sports drinks wisely, as some contain high levels of sugar. Choosing for low-sugar or electrolyte-focused drinks can provide the necessary benefits site link without excessive calories.
Another important approach is to monitor urine color as an indicator of hydration level. A light yellow color typically signifies proper hydration, while deep urine may indicate dehydration. This simple method helps people evaluate their fluid intake and make modifications as needed. Additionally, eating hydrating foods such as fruits and vegetables can contribute to overall fluid intake. Foods like melon, cucumbers, and oranges have high water content and can support hydration initiatives.
Finally, developing a hydration plan can enhance recovery after exercise. This strategy should include specific amounts of water and electrolytes to consume based on personal activity levels and surrounding conditions. By setting hydration goals, individuals can ensure they fulfill their needs consistently.
